Council approves five-year fiber, internet and phone agreement with CTC

Wrenshall City Council · February 4, 2026

The council approved a five-year service agreement with CTC to install fiber optic service and provide internet and phone services at city hall. The clerk also announced a local student poster contest winner.

The council approved a five-year service agreement with CTC for fiber-optic installation and ongoing internet and phone services at city hall. The motion to approve the CTC agreement was made by Councilor Sabrina Weber and seconded by Steve Studniski; the motion carried.

At the start of the item, the clerk congratulated Hattie Ankrum for winning the MRWA fourth-grade poster contest; the poster will advance to further judging at the MRWA annual conference. The CTC agreement will proceed as approved and installation scheduling and costs are to be managed through the city clerk’s office under the approved contract.
